About Marko Vendelin
Marko Vendelin is a scholar working on Molecular Biology, Cardiology and Cardiovascular Medicine, Radiology, Nuclear Medicine and Imaging, Biophysics and Physiology, having authored 70 papers that have together received 1.9k indexed citations. Recurring topics across this work include Mitochondrial Function and Pathology (22 papers), Cardiac electrophysiology and arrhythmias (19 papers), Advanced MRI Techniques and Applications (15 papers), Ion channel regulation and function (13 papers), Cardiomyopathy and Myosin Studies (12 papers), Adipose Tissue and Metabolism (11 papers), Cardiovascular Function and Risk Factors (10 papers) and Muscle metabolism and nutrition (6 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(596 citations), Biophysics (107 citations), Molecular Biology (1.1k citations), Clinical Biochemistry (90 citations) and Physiology (311 citations). Marko Vendelin has collaborated with scholars based in Estonia, France and United States. Frequent co-authors include Valdur Saks, Rikke Birkedal, Martin Laasmaa, Pearu Peterson, Laurence Kay, Uwe Schlattner, Tatiana Andrienko, Jüri Engelbrecht, Theo Wallimann and Karen Guerrero. Their work appears in journals such as Biophysical Journal, PLoS ONE, American Journal of Physiology-Cell Physiology, American Journal of Physiology-Heart and Circulatory Physiology and Scientific Reports.
